Niall Canavan

Niall David Stephen Canavan ( born April 11, 1991, Leeds ) is an English footballer who currently plays at third division Scunthorpe United.

The Defender is Player of Scunthorpe United since his youth. He signed his first professional contract in April 2009. His first league game he played 22 August 2009 in the 0-4 defeat against Sheffield Wednesday, when he came off the bench in 28 minutes for Rob Jones. Just three days later, he scored in the League Cup match against Swansea City, which was won 2-1 with his first goal. Swansea City finished the game with only eight players after Ángel Rangel, Garry Monk and Gorka Pintado had been dismissed.

In his seventh deployment in the Football League Championship 2 May 2010 Canavan scored his first goal in league play. Here he met in the home game against Nottingham Forest to 1:2, the game ended in a 2-2 draw. In May 2010, he extended his contract with the Irons for another three years.
